LEWIS AND CLARK BEHAVIORAL is a community nonprofit in the Mental Health sector that reported $8.7M in total revenue in fiscal year 2017. Expenses of $8.4M left a modest 3% surplus.

Mission

TO PROVIDE A BROAD SPECTRUM OF MENTAL HEALTH SERVICES TO RESIDENTS OF SOUTH DAKOTA
